logo

Output 312477dc8e20ef5490b8048c15431590d0b107682ea6697c0cdf95fe7b3b7d26:2

value
5504059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 186aa13cd589e44b98cf18c2cc6876d1b42329de OP_EQUAL
address
33v7svDz8haj8xoYwMZNWADPHgjUindsQD
transaction
312477dc8e20ef5490b8048c15431590d0b107682ea6697c0cdf95fe7b3b7d26